简单易懂!DNS服务器添加解析教程详解 (dns服务器添加解析)

在进行网站建设或者域名解析时,许多人都会涉及到 DNS(Domn Name System)服务器添加解析的问题。DNS服务器是通过域名解析将用户输入的网址转化成与之对应的IP地址,帮助用户快速访问网站。本篇文章将就如何添加DNS服务器以及如何进行域名解析提供详细解析,以期帮助用户快速了解DNS服务器的具体操作方法。

1. DNS服务器的基本概念

DNS服务器实际上就是一个保存大量IP地址与域名的服务器。当用户输入一个网址时,DNS服务器会自动地将此网址所对应的IP地址进行查询,并将其返回给用户。也就是说,我们操作DNS服务器的目的就是为了将所需要使用的域名与其对应的IP地址相联系,达到方便访问目的的效果。

2. 如何添加DNS服务器?

在各种不同的操作系统中,DNS服务器的添加方法也有所不同。我们下面就将对不同操作系统下的DNS服务器添加方法进行详细介绍。

2.1 Windows 操作系统下的 DNS 服务器添加

我们需要右键点击计算机选择“属性”,在打开的窗口中,点击“高级系统设置”。在“高级系统设置”的窗口中,点击“环境变量”选项卡,在“用户变量”或者“系统变量”中选择“PATH”。将添加服务器的DNS地址添加在“变量值”中。

2.2 Mac OS X 操作系统下的 DNS 服务器添加

在Mac OS X 系统中,DNS服务器的添加非常简单易操作,只需要在“系统偏好设置”中选择网络,在下拉菜单中选项“高级”并选择“DNS”。依次添加所需要使用的DNS服务器地址即可。

2.3 Linux 操作系统下的 DNS 服务器添加

在Linux操作系统中,人们通常使用的是“resolv.conf”文件,而resolv.conf文件中的DNS服务器的设置也是依靠配置的方式进行。我们需要打开“resolv.conf”文件并在其中修改内容。输入以下语句:

nameserver DNS服务器地址

3. 如何进行域名解析?

当DNS服务器添加成功后,我们也需要对其进行一些配置操作,使其与具体的域名相对应,从而实现域名解析。

3.1 域名解析的基本原理

Windows 操作系统中的域名解析可以分为两类:本地解析和远程解析。本地解析一般是基于hosts文件进行添加。在本机上添加网址与IP地址的对应关系。这些关系会在本地内存中进行缓存,并可以快速访问。而远程解析通常是基于DNS服务器进行添加,其原理与DNS服务器的逻辑相似,可以比较精确地查找所需要的IP地址。

3.2 如何进行域名解析?

在进行域名解析时,我们需要打开DNS服务器的控制面板,点击添加。在弹出的界面中输入所需要访问的域名以及对应的IP地址即可完成域名解析操作。这一过程相对简单易懂,但对于新手而言还是需要多加注意,避免因为疏忽而出现错误。

4. 品质优秀的DNS服务器推荐

除了自己搭建DNS服务器外,为了保证网络的访问速度以及可靠性,我们也可以选择一些已经得到大量用户保障的DNS服务器进行添加。如阿里云、百度等DNS服务器都是性能优秀,使用顺畅的DNS服务器之一。

综上所述,DNS服务器是进行网站建设与域名解析不可缺少的重要组成部分。本篇文章主要介绍了DNS服务器的添加以及域名解析的基本方法,希望对广大用户提供帮助。同时,我们也推荐几种性能优秀的DNS服务器,希望读者可以根据自己的实际需求进行选择。

相关问题拓展阅读:

CentOS7 搭建 DNS 域名解析服务器

主要参考知识

centOS7下DNS服务器的安装与配置 – csdn – 主要参考

CentOS7.3使用BIND配置DNS服务器(一) – csdn – 主要参考

四、bind(named)配置文件 – csdn

Linux系统下搭建DNS服务器——DNS原理总结 – csdn – 从概念层面看 DNS 解析

DNS正反向解析库配置篇(一) – csdn – 正反向解析文件配置

DNS配置详解 BIND实现正向解析和反向解析 – cnblog – 正反向解析文件配置

DNS域名解析服务–Named服务 – 说明详细

搭建DNS服务器 – – 域名解析文件配置说明

Linux中DNS配置 – csdn – 配置文件语法检查用的比较好

linux中dns服务器的搭建 – csdn – nslookup 使用的比较好

其他扩展知识

反向域名解析有什么功能? – 百度百科

Centos7/RHEL7中的ifconfig、netstat、route几个常用指令被替代 – csdn

运维小技巧:使用ss命令代替 netstat,和netstat说再见 – csdn

Linux安装nslookup – csdn

如图:

修改前先备份: cp -p /etc/named.conf /etc/named.conf.bak // 参数-p表示备份文件与源文件的属性一致。

修改配置: vi /etc/named.conf , 配置内容如下:

检查一波

添加配置: vi /etc/named.rfc1912.zones , 配置内容如下:

基于 name.localhost 模板,创建配置文件: cp -p /var/named/named.localhost /var/named/named.reading.zt

配置正向域名解析文件 named.reading.zt : vi /var/named/named.reading.zt ,配置内容如下:

说明:

授权 named 用户 chown :named /var/named/named.reading.zt

检查区域文件是否正确 named-checkzone “reading.zt” “/var/named/named.reading.zt” ,如图:

基于 name.localhost 模板,创建配置文件: cp -p /var/named/named.localhost /var/named/named.192.168.0

配置反向域名解析文件 named.192.168.0 : vi /var/named/named.192.168.0

授权 named 用户 chown :named /var/named/named.192.168.0

检查区域文件是否正确 named-checkzone “0.168.192.in-addr.arpa” “/var/named/named.192.168.0” ,如图:

重启 named 服务,让配置生效 systemctl restart named

配置 ifcfg-x vi /etc/sysconfig/network-scripts/ifcfg-enp0s3 , 具体内容如下:

如图:

重启网络服务,让配置生效 systemctl restart network.service

bind-utils 软件包本身提供了测试工具 nslookup

nslookup test.reading.zt , 或者,如下图:

dns服务器添加解析的介绍就聊到这里吧,感谢你花时间阅读本站内容,更多关于dns服务器添加解析,简单易懂!DNS服务器添加解析教程详解,CentOS7 搭建 DNS 域名解析服务器的信息别忘了在本站进行查找喔。


数据运维技术 » 简单易懂!DNS服务器添加解析教程详解 (dns服务器添加解析)